In this blog post, we will explore the importance and benefits of responsive web design for mobile users.
Understanding the concept of responsive web design
Responsive web design is an approach to web design that ensures a website's layout and content adapt to different screen sizes and devices. It aims to provide an optimal user experience irrespective of the device being used. By using fluid grids, flexible images, and media queries, responsive web design allows websites to automatically adjust their layout and content to fit the screen size of the user's device.
This concept is crucial for mobile users as it enables them to view and interact with a website seamlessly, regardless of whether they are using a smartphone, tablet, or any other mobile device. With the increasing popularity of mobile browsing, it is essential for website owners to prioritize responsive web design to cater to the needs of their mobile audience.
Key benefits of responsive web design for mobile users
1. Improved user experience: Responsive web design ensures that mobile users can easily navigate and interact with a website. By providing a user-friendly interface and optimized content, it enhances the overall user experience and encourages visitors to stay longer on the site.
2. Increased mobile traffic: With a responsive website, mobile users are more likely to visit and explore the site. This can lead to a significant increase in mobile traffic, as users are more likely to engage with a mobile-friendly website.
3. Better search engine visibility: Responsive web design is favored by search engines like Google, as it provides a consistent user experience across devices. Websites that are mobile-friendly are more likely to rank higher in search engine results, increasing visibility and organic traffic.
4. Cost and time efficiency: Instead of creating separate websites or mobile apps for different devices, responsive web design allows businesses to maintain a single website that adapts to various screen sizes. This saves time and resources in development and maintenance.
5. Future-proofing: As technology continues to evolve, new devices with different screen sizes will emerge. Responsive web design ensures that a website is ready to adapt to these changes, future-proofing it against the need for constant updates and redesigns.
Best practices for implementing responsive web design
1. Use a mobile-first approach: Start designing and developing your website by prioritizing the mobile experience. This ensures that the most important content and features are optimized for mobile users.
2. Optimize images and media: Compress images and videos to reduce file sizes and improve loading times on mobile devices. Use responsive image techniques to serve appropriately sized images based on the user's device.
3. Prioritize performance: Mobile users often have slower internet connections compared to desktop users. Optimize your website's performance by minifying code, leveraging browser caching, and reducing server response time.
4. Utilize breakpoints effectively: Set breakpoints in your CSS to define when the layout and design of your website should change based on different screen sizes. This ensures a smooth transition between different devices.
5. Test and iterate: Regularly test your website on different mobile devices and screen sizes to ensure a consistent and optimized user experience. Gather feedback from users and make iterative improvements to enhance mobile usability.
Tools and resources for optimizing your website for mobile users
1. Responsive design frameworks: Frameworks like Bootstrap and Foundation provide pre-built components and responsive grid systems that can expedite the development of a responsive website.
2. Responsive testing tools: Tools like BrowserStack and Responsinator allow you to test your website's responsiveness across a wide range of devices and screen sizes.
3. Performance optimization tools: Tools like Google PageSpeed Insights and GTmetrix can help you identify performance bottlenecks and suggest optimizations to improve your website's loading speed on mobile devices.
4. Content delivery networks (CDNs): CDNs like Cloudflare can help deliver your website's content faster to mobile users by caching it on servers located closer to them.
5. User feedback and analytics tools: Tools like Hotjar and Google Analytics can provide valuable insights into how mobile users interact with your website, allowing you to make data-driven optimizations.
Tags:
Jun 13, 2024 8:49:45 PM
Comments